SQL Ninja-Herramienta de asistencia gratuita para consultas SQL
Potencie sus habilidades de base de datos con IA
Can you help me write a SQL query that...
What is the best way to...
I need an example of a SQL statement that...
How do I optimize a query for...
Herramientas relacionadas
Cargar másNinjatrader Coder
Ninjatrader Coding Assistant
SQL Wingman
Expert SQL assistant for pros, specializing in Microsoft SQL.
Ninja Developer
Multilingual code ninja, silently perfecting and imparting code craft.
Test ninja
.NET Ninja
Code refactoring, troubleshooting, problem solving, creative solutions, using SOLID, DRY, Best practices
TSQL APP Action Script Trainer
Trains users in T-SQL.APP action scripts with accuracy and updated info.
Introducción a SQL Ninja
SQL Ninja es un asistente digital especializado diseñado para facilitar a los usuarios la creación y comprensión de consultas SQL. Con una misión central de desmitificar SQL y mejorar la competencia en la interacción con bases de datos, SQL Ninja sirve como mentor, similar al Sr. Miyagi de Karate Kid, guiando a los usuarios a través de los matices de SQL con paciencia y sabiduría. Ayuda a los usuarios a formular consultas, comprender conceptos de bases de datos y aplicar las mejores prácticas de SQL. Ya sea que seas un principiante que busca comprender las declaraciones SELECT básicas o un desarrollador experimentado que elabora JOIN y transacciones complejas, SQL Ninja proporciona las herramientas y perspectivas necesarias. Por ejemplo, si un usuario tiene problemas para escribir una consulta para filtrar resultados según condiciones específicas, SQL Ninja no solo proporcionaría la sintaxis SQL exacta, sino que también explicaría la lógica detrás de ella, asegurando que el usuario no solo resuelva el problema inmediato, sino que también aprenda los conceptos subyacentes. Powered by ChatGPT-4o。
Principales funciones de SQL Ninja
Guía para la elaboración de consultas
Example
SELECT * FROM Customers WHERE Country = 'Germany';
Scenario
Un usuario desea recuperar todos los registros de la tabla 'Customers' donde el país es Alemania. SQL Ninja guía en la construcción de la consulta, explicando la importancia de la cláusula WHERE para el filtrado.
Mejores prácticas de diseño de bases de datos
Example
CREATE TABLE Products (ProductID int PRIMARY KEY, ProductName varchar(255), Price decimal);
Scenario
Cuando un usuario está diseñando una nueva base de datos, SQL Ninja asesora sobre la definición de tablas con los tipos de datos apropiados y claves principales, garantizando una organización y recuperación de datos eficientes.
Consejos de optimización de rendimiento
Example
CREATE INDEX idx_customer_name ON Customers (CustomerName);
Scenario
Para una base de datos que sufre de respuestas de consulta lentas, SQL Ninja sugiere crear índices en las columnas utilizadas frecuentemente en las cláusulas WHERE, mejorando significativamente el rendimiento de las consultas.
Comprensión de conceptos SQL complejos
Example
SELECT Orders.OrderID, Customers.CustomerName FROM Orders INNER JOIN Customers ON Orders.CustomerID = Customers.CustomerID;
Scenario
Un usuario necesita unir dos tablas para correlacionar pedidos con los nombres de los clientes. SQL Ninja analiza el concepto JOIN, asegurando que el usuario comprenda cómo combinar tablas de manera efectiva.
Usuarios ideales de SQL Ninja
Principiantes en SQL
Personas nuevas en SQL que buscan una comprensión fundamental de la escritura de consultas, operaciones de bases de datos y manipulación básica de datos. SQL Ninja ofrece una introducción amigable a la sintaxis SQL y sus principios, haciendo que el consulta de bases de datos sea menos intimidante.
Usuarios de bases de datos intermedios
Aquellos con alguna experiencia en SQL que buscan profundizar sus conocimientos en áreas como consultas complejas, diseño de bases de datos y optimización. SQL Ninja ofrece explicaciones y ejemplos detallados para salvar la brecha entre el uso básico y avanzado de SQL.
Analistas de datos y científicos de datos
Profesionales que utilizan SQL para análisis de datos, generación de informes o proyectos de ciencia de datos. SQL Ninja ayuda a elaborar consultas eficientes, comprender las relaciones de datos y optimizar las interacciones con la base de datos para análisis.
Desarrolladores de software
Desarrolladores que integran bases de datos SQL en aplicaciones y necesitan garantizar un diseño óptimo de la base de datos, seguridad y rendimiento de consultas. SQL Ninja asesora sobre las mejores prácticas y patrones para aplicaciones de base de datos robustas y escalables.
Pautas para usar SQL Ninja
Comience su viaje
Comience visitando yeschat.ai para una prueba gratuita, accesible sin necesidad de iniciar sesión o suscribirse a ChatGPT Plus.
Familiarícese con los conceptos básicos de SQL
Antes de sumergirse, asegúrese de tener una comprensión básica de SQL. Esto incluye saber cómo escribir consultas simples, comprender esquemas de bases de datos y sintaxis SQL básica.
Identifique sus necesidades de consulta
Defina claramente el objetivo de su consulta SQL. Ya sea recuperación de datos, modificación o alteración de la estructura de la base de datos, conocer su objetivo ayuda a elaborar consultas precisas.
Interactúe con SQL Ninja
Interactúe con SQL Ninja presentando sus consultas o problemas relacionados con SQL. Sea específico sobre su entorno de base de datos y requisitos para obtener una asistencia más adaptada.
Aplique y experimente
Utilice las soluciones SQL proporcionadas en su entorno de base de datos. Para una práctica segura, pruebe primero las consultas en un entorno de desarrollo. Reflexione e itere en función de los resultados.
Prueba otros GPTs avanzados y prácticos
Pitch Perfect
Elevating Sales with AI-Powered Precision
Art Mystic
Liberando la creatividad con el virtuosismo de la IA
Data Structurer Pro
Estructurando datos, simplificando complejidad
Integration Pro
Potenciando la innovación con la integración de IA
Zoomer FinFluencer
Revolucionando las finanzas con perspectivas impulsadas por IA
Chrome Extension Guru
Potenciando el desarrollo de extensiones de Chrome con IA
HTML Wizard
Guía de desarrollo web impulsada por IA encantadora
The Pythoneer
Desenreda los misterios de Python con orientación impulsada por IA
Gimp Bot
Craft, Create, and Captivate with AI
MetaGPT
Elevando las interacciones de IA con orientación adaptada
Character Architect
Diseña personajes convincentes con la IA
Fairy Soapmother
Elabore jabones mágicos con IA
Preguntas frecuentes sobre SQL Ninja
¿Puede SQL Ninja ayudar con la optimización de consultas complejas?
Absolutamente. SQL Ninja puede ayudar a optimizar consultas SQL complejas sugiriendo estructuras de consultas más eficientes, estrategias de indexación e incluso reescribiendo consultas para un mejor rendimiento.
¿Es SQL Ninja adecuado para principiantes en SQL?
Sí, SQL Ninja está diseñado para ayudar a usuarios de todos los niveles, incluidos los principiantes. Ofrece explicaciones simples y orientación paso a paso para ayudar a los recién llegados a comprender y escribir consultas SQL.
¿Cómo maneja SQL Ninja la sintaxis específica de la base de datos?
SQL Ninja conoce varios dialectos SQL. Puede adaptar consultas a sistemas de bases de datos específicos como MySQL, PostgreSQL u Oracle, considerando su sintaxis y funcionalidades únicas.
¿Puedo usar SQL Ninja para aprender SQL?
Definitivamente. SQL Ninja es una excelente herramienta para aprender SQL. No solo proporciona soluciones de consultas, sino que también explica el razonamiento detrás de ellas, ayudando en el proceso de aprendizaje.
¿SQL Ninja ofrece soporte para características SQL avanzadas?
Sí, es compatible con características SQL avanzadas como funciones de ventana, expresiones de tabla común (CTE) y manejo de JSON, proporcionando orientación y ejemplos para su uso.